Ethiopia is actually a renowned but barely explored and acknowledged location. The region marketplaces by itself given that the land of origin; it's the cradle of humankind and Coffea arabica and civilizations and natural beauty. Having said that, It's also a country of distinction where the twenty-to start with century has hardly arrived. Ethiopia is the most important landlocked nation on the planet which has a population that now exceeds one hundred ten million, with some 5.two million farmers regarded as coffee growers. Consequently, Despite the fact that Ethiopians mature some five percent on the coffee, they symbolize not less than twenty per cent of the world’s coffee farmers.

Ethiopia acknowledges technology and tourism as pillars for your sustainable advancement agenda and weather alter resilient economy; coffee has an awesome likely to thrive in these sectors. To at the present time, a lot more coffee is cultivated in normal forests than commercial farms. In reality, it would be better to express that coffee with the normal or managed forests of Ethiopia is only harvested when character nevertheless can take care of the cultivation! Inside of specialty coffee, processing solutions that go beyond uncomplicated washed coffee that entail various fermentation processes on both of those purely natural and washed coffee types at the moment are getting   “ the point to carry out,” but fermentation- dependent purely natural coffee processing techniques have very long been an indicator of Ethiopian coffee. Ethiopia continue to produces the vast majority of its coffee by means of pure drying solutions and smallholder farmers continue to use some kind of fermentation of the cherries ahead of drying.

The evolution of coffee in Ethiopia is kind of distinct. To this day coffee continues to be a social consume in which it's freshly roasted, floor, and brewed for quick use by Ladies in your house above a ceremony that lasts properly about an hour. The attachment of Ethiopian Gals to coffee is so dominant, Ethiopians would only be puzzled to listen to from the existence of initiatives such as #ShesTheRoaster that are meant to provide about equality and equity in the global coffee sector.

The topography of Ethiopia is mesmerizing, earning ethiopian coffee it the nickname “the rooftop of Africa”; while the suggest elevation is one, 330 meters previously mentioned sea stage (masl), Ethiopia is house to at least one of the bottom details while in the Danakil Despair at −a hundred twenty five masl and the best point of Ras Dejen at 4,550 masl. Because of this, Ethiopia is usually a globally regarded hotspot for biodiversity. Its Culture is usually a melting pot of cultures and religions:  it really is in which Judaism, Christianity, and Islam coexisted, since their early times, with all eighty in addition ethnic teams and languages all dwelling with each other as minority groups. Luckily, they all share the coffee enthusiasm as coffee growers and/or individuals.
